Typical Types of Door Hinge Problems
Understanding the common concerns related to cheap door hinge repair hinges can assist property owners and entrepreneur identify problems early, preventing pricey repairs or replacements down the line. Here's a list of normal hinge issues:
| Issue | Description | Service |
|---|---|---|
| Squeaky Hinges | Hinges can become noisy due to absence of lubrication or dirt buildup. | Apply lubricant or change the hinge if harmed. |
| Misalignment | Doors that do not line up properly can trigger issues with opening and closing. | Adjust the hinge placement or replace it if significantly worn. |
| Rust and Corrosion | Metal hinges exposed to wetness can rust, weakening their integrity. | Clean rusted hinges and use protective coating or change. |
| Damaged Bushings | Bushings can use down with time, resulting in loose hinges and a shaky door hinge specialist. | Change one or both bushings to bring back stability. |
| Broken Hinges | Physical damage to the hinge can prevent correct door operation and poses a safety threat. | Change the damaged hinge as quickly as possible. |
| Loose Screws | Hinges can become loose due to frequent usage, affecting the door's performance. | Tighten or change screws to secure the hinge effectively. |

FAQ
1. How typically should I have my door hinges checked?
It is a good idea to examine door hinges a minimum of as soon as a year, especially if they experience heavy use. Regular maintenance can prevent major problems.
2. Can I fix a squeaky hinge myself?
Yes, you can generally fix a squeaky hinge yourself by applying a lubricant like WD-40 or silicone spray. If the issue continues, consider looking for professional help.
3. What should I do if my door won't close effectively?
If your door won't close properly, check for misalignment or loose hinges. Tightening screws may solve the issue, however if the issue continues, consult a repair service.
4. Is it much better to replace or repair a broken hinge?
If the hinge is substantially harmed, it is typically much better to replace it to guarantee long-term performance and security. A professional can assist determine the very best strategy.
5. How long does hinge repair typically take?
Generally, hinge repair can be finished in under an hour, depending upon the degree of the damage and the number of hinges involved.
